Transport Rule

  1.  The school Conveyance is available only on existing routes
  2. Bus fee has to paid from Twelve months.
  3. One month advance notice must be given before discontinuing the use of the bus or a one-month fee in lieu of notice.
  4. Parents /Students are not permitted to add new stops for their conveyance without seeking permission from the principal.
  5. Parents are requested to note that the bus routes are fixed after careful planning and no route can be changed or extended to suit individual need.
  6. Drop your ward at the bus stop a few minutes before the scheduled time for the arrival of the school bus. Make sure that you are at the bus stop well in time to receive your wards after school.

If the child is availing bus facility and for some reason, the parent have to collect their wards earlier, a prior note to the class teachers along with a letter of request addressed to the principal should be sent. The parents should come personally at the reception to collect their ward. The child will not be handed over from gate in such a case.

Private Transport

  1. You are advised to take necessary steps and have the phone numbers, address, I-Cards, and Police Verification of your ward's Tampo, Van Driver.
  2. Inform the school authorities about the transporter and the means of transport.
  3. The School holds no  responsibility for these private vehicles, but we are concerned about the safety of the students . So please stay alert. 

Precautions and Safety Measures

1. Students must reach the bus stop at least a few minutes before the scheduled time for the arrival of the school bus.

2. Students should always stay away from the main road while waiting for the school bu.

3. Students should not board or alight from the bus until the bus has come to complete halt.

4. Students should remain seated and not move around when the bus is in motion.

5. Students should not lean out of the window or stick their limbs out.

6. Students should occupy vacant seats immediately after boarding the school bus.

7. Senior students should look after the younger ones offering them their seats.

8. The front door is the only authorized entrance and exit point. Only the conductor authorized to open the door.
